Definition
UNSPSC 64101904A type of loan in which the lender agrees to lend a maximum amount within an agreed period where the collateral is the borrower's equity in his or her house. The borrower is not advanced the entire sum up front, but uses a line of credit to borrow sums that total no more than the credit limit, similar to a credit card. HELOC funds can be borrowed during the draw period --typically 5 to 25 years. Repayment is of the amount drawn plus interest. The full principal amount is due at the end of the draw period, either as a lump-sum balloon payment or according to a loan amortization schedule.
